Exploring Monetization Options for Your YouTube Channel
Once you’ve established a solid subscriber base and consistent viewership, it’s time to dive into the various monetization strategies available for your YouTube channel. Ad revenue remains one of the most popular methods, allowing creators to earn a share of the ad earnings from the videos they publish. However, alongside ads, consider leveraging YouTube Premium revenue, which pays creators based on watch time from Premium subscribers. Additionally, brand partnerships offer lucrative opportunities for direct sponsorships, allowing you to collaborate with companies relevant to your niche while generating revenue through sponsored content.
Moreover, merchandising can unlock another revenue stream, allowing you to promote and sell branded products to your audience. Engaging your viewers with membership options can also provide a steady income through exclusive content, badges, and access to community features. Don’t underestimate the potential of affiliate marketing, where you earn commissions by promoting products linked in your video descriptions. Here’s a brief overview of these monetization options:
| Monetization Method | Revenue Source | Key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| Ad Revenue | Advertisements | Passive income from views |
| YouTube Premium | Subscription share | Earn from Premium viewers |
| Brand Partnerships | Sponsorships | Direct collaboration with companies |
| Merchandising | Product sales | Strengthen brand identity |
| Membership Options | Subscriptions | Regular income through exclusives |
| Affiliate Marketing | Commissions on sales | Promote products you love |

Leveraging Analytics to Maximize Your Revenue Potential
Analyzing viewer behavior on your channel is crucial for identifying what content resonates most with your audience. By diving deep into analytics, you can determine which videos attract the highest engagement and retention rates. Focus on metrics such as watch time, click-through rate (CTR), and audience demographics to tailor your content strategy. Use this data to create video series, themed content, or collaborations that align with viewer interests. Moreover, implement A/B testing for thumbnails and titles to see what drives more clicks and improves your visibility in search results. This informed approach not only enhances viewer satisfaction but also boosts revenue through increased ad impressions and sponsorship opportunities.
